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Parse Server
- Deployment complexity and scaling challenges require operational expertise
- Requires database management skills for MongoDB or PostgreSQL administration
- Smaller community and ecosystem compared to Firebase or cloud alternatives
- Query depth bypass vulnerability allowing denial-of-service attacks via complex REST/GraphQL queries
- Stored XSS vulnerability through SVG file uploads requires patching
Rutter
- A unified schema exposes only the fields common across platforms, so the platform-specific detail underwriting models want usually requires passthrough calls and per-platform code, which is the work the unified API was bought to avoid.
- Write operations into accounting systems are where these products break, because each system validates differently, and a rejected journal entry surfaces as a support ticket against you rather than against the ERP.
- No pricing is published beyond a sandbox trial, so cost cannot be compared against alternatives without a sales process, and pricing tends to scale with connected accounts.
- QuickBooks Desktop and other on-premises systems require a local connector or hosted agent, which introduces installation steps your customers must complete and support burden you inherit.
- Sync freshness varies by platform and by customer authorisation state, so a product promising near real-time figures will find some connections update far less often than the marketing implies.

Answered from the vendors’ own pages
Parse Server: Is Parse Server self-hosted or cloud-managed?
Parse Server is entirely self-hosted and open-source, running on your own infrastructure with no monthly subscription required; you manage the MongoDB or PostgreSQL database and deployment.
Rutter: Does Rutter support QuickBooks Desktop?
Yes, which distinguishes it from unified APIs that only cover cloud accounting, and matters because many small businesses still run it.
Parse Server: What databases does Parse Server support?
Parse Server works with MongoDB and PostgreSQL as data stores, giving you flexibility to choose your preferred database system for your application.
Rutter: Can Rutter write data back?
Yes. Invoices, bills and journal entries can be pushed into supported accounting systems, not only read.
Parse Server: What APIs does Parse Server provide?
Parse Server automatically generates both REST and GraphQL APIs based on your application schema, and you can extend these with custom queries, mutations, and remote schemas.
SourceRutter: Is there a free tier?
There is a thirty day sandbox trial with test data. Production access requires a paid plan with quoted pricing.
Parse Server: What SDKs are available for Parse Server?
Parse provides native SDKs for iOS (Swift/Objective-C), Android, JavaScript/Node.js, PHP, and .NET, plus REST and GraphQL access for any other platform.
SourceRutter: What if the unified model lacks a field I need?
Rutter supports passthrough requests to the underlying platform API, though using them reintroduces platform-specific code.
Parse Server: Does Parse Server include user authentication?
Yes. Parse Server includes out-of-the-box user management with support for email/password authentication, OAuth providers (Facebook, Twitter, Google, GitHub, LDAP), push notifications, and campaigns.
